Output 43c03b402ec76e3a90bc097708a9906e6bdd1a8c8d82522c398cd949d3090f70:7

value
52221856
script pubkey
OP_0 OP_PUSHBYTES_20 874fe4cad0308690f60cd93843df3de59c81789d
address
bc1qsa87fjksxzrfpasvmyuy8heaukwgz7yau2nkek
transaction
43c03b402ec76e3a90bc097708a9906e6bdd1a8c8d82522c398cd949d3090f70
confirmations
12410
spent
true